The phrase "and to meet the needs of" is correct and usable in written English.
It can be used when discussing the purpose of a service, product, or initiative aimed at fulfilling specific requirements or demands.
Example: "Our organization is committed to providing high-quality services and to meet the needs of our diverse clientele."
Alternatives: "and to address the requirements of" or "and to fulfill the demands of".
